Paolo Bracchi (died 1497) was a Roman Catholic prelate who served as Bishop of Ariano (1481–1497). [1]

Biography

In 1481, he was appointed Bishop of Ariano by Pope Sixtus IV. [1] [2] He served as Bishop of Ariano until his death in 1497. [1] [2]
